  • 質問: What is Ab Initio Molecular Dynamics?

    回答: Ab Initio Molecular Dynamics (AIMD) is a computational simulation method used to study the dynamic behavior of molecular systems based on quantum mechanics. Rather than relying on empirical potentials, AIMD calculates forces derived directly from quantum mechanical principles. This allows for more accurate modeling of molecular interactions and reactions, making it invaluable in fields like chemistry and materials science. For researchers, AIMD provides insights into phenomena like reaction dynamics, material properties, and temperature effects, which are difficult to capture with classical methods.

  • 質問: How does AIMD differ from classical molecular dynamics?

    回答: AIMD differs from classical molecular dynamics primarily in its approach to calculating forces acting on atoms. While classical methods use empirical potential energy functions to model interactions, AIMD derives forces based on quantum mechanical calculations, leading to increased accuracy in simulating chemical reactions and dynamics. This distinction makes AIMD particularly useful for studying systems where electronic effects are significant, such as bond formation and breaking. Consequently, AIMD provides deeper insights into processes often missed by classical approaches.
